Feeding Schedule and Portion Sizes

Setting a consistent feeding schedule is vital for Golden Retriever puppies. They thrive on a predictable routine, which can also assist in house training. Typically, puppies should be fed three to four times a day until they reach six months of age. After this period, the frequency can be reduced to two meals per day.

The recommended portion sizes depend on the puppy’s age, weight, and activity level. It is essential to follow the guidelines provided on the Royal Canin Puppy food packaging, which are based on the puppy’s weight. For example, a 10-pound Golden Retriever puppy may require approximately 1.5 to 2 cups of food daily, while a 20-pound puppy may need about 2.5 to 3 cups.

The following table provides a general guideline for feeding Golden Retriever puppies based on age and weight:

Age (Months) Weight Range (lbs) Daily Portions (cups)
2-3 5-10 1-1.5
4-5 10-20 1.5-2.5
6-8 20-30 2.5-3.5

Importance of Transitioning to Royal Canin Puppy Food

Transitioning to Royal Canin Puppy food from a previous diet is crucial for avoiding digestive upset and ensuring that the puppy receives a balanced diet. A gradual transition is recommended, typically over a period of 7 to 10 days, to allow the puppy’s digestive system to adjust.

Begin by mixing a small amount of Royal Canin Puppy food with the current food, gradually increasing the proportion of Royal Canin while decreasing the previous food. By the end of the transition period, the puppy should be eating only Royal Canin. This method not only eases the transition but also helps to monitor the puppy for any adverse reactions.

Signs of Overfeeding or Underfeeding

Recognizing the signs of overfeeding or underfeeding in Golden Retrievers is essential for maintaining their health. Overfeeding can lead to obesity, which poses a risk for various health issues such as joint problems and heart disease. Conversely, underfeeding can result in stunted growth and nutritional deficiencies.

Signs of overfeeding may include:
– Excessive weight gain
– Lethargy or decreased activity levels
– Difficulty in physical activities such as running or playing

On the other hand, signs of underfeeding can include:
– Noticeable weight loss
– Rib visibility or a gaunt appearance
– Low energy levels or lack of enthusiasm during play

Monitoring your puppy’s weight regularly and adjusting their feed according to their growth and activity level is essential for a healthy and happy Golden Retriever.

Health Considerations When Choosing Puppy Food

Royal canin puppy golden retriever

Golden Retrievers are beloved for their friendly demeanor and intelligence, but they are also prone to specific health issues that can be influenced by diet. Feeding the right nutrition during their formative years is crucial for preventing and managing these health risks. Properly formulated puppy food, such as Royal Canin Puppy for Golden Retrievers, can play a significant role in promoting long-term health and well-being.

One of the most common health concerns for Golden Retrievers is hip dysplasia, a genetic condition that can result in arthritis as they age. A balanced diet rich in omega fatty acids, antioxidants, and joint-supporting nutrients can help maintain healthy joints and reduce inflammation. Another issue is obesity, which can exacerbate various health problems, including heart disease and diabetes. Feeding controlled portions of high-quality puppy food can help manage weight effectively.

Benefits of Wet vs. Dry Royal Canin Puppy Food for Golden Retrievers

The choice between wet and dry puppy food can also impact the health of Golden Retrievers. Each type offers unique benefits that can cater to different needs.

– Dry Puppy Food:
– Convenient and easy to store.
– Helps maintain dental health by reducing plaque and tartar buildup.
– Often higher in calories, which is beneficial for active puppies.

– Wet Puppy Food:
– Higher moisture content aids in hydration.
– Often more palatable, which can be advantageous for picky eaters or those recovering from illness.
– Provides added texture variation, which can stimulate appetite and interest in meals.

Both formats can be beneficial when used in combination, allowing for a balanced approach to hydration and nutrition.

What age can I start feeding Royal Canin Puppy food?

You can start feeding Royal Canin Puppy food as soon as your Golden Retriever puppy is weaned, typically around 8 weeks old.

How much Royal Canin Puppy food should I feed my puppy?

The amount varies based on your puppy’s age, weight, and activity level; refer to the feeding guide on the packaging for specific recommendations.

Can I mix Royal Canin Puppy food with other brands?

While it is possible to mix foods, gradual transitions are recommended to avoid digestive issues; ideally, stick with one brand for consistency.
